TenM Supplied Material and Labor to Ithaca Apartment Complex

The Aurora at Cayuga Park is a newly constructed, premier mixed-use development located in Ithaca, New York. 

Now home to 141 luxury apartments and premium commercial space, TenM brought this multi-scope project to life with our turnkey, multi-trade approach. We supplied materials and labor for the large scale wood framing and exterior courtyard paver system. Led by Zach Schiffer, our team completed the interior trim and doors after the structural framing envelope was in place. With dedicated crews working across multiple trades, we maintained momentum and delivered the project efficiently from start to finish.

The Scope of Work

TenM was involved in both exterior and interior jobs on The Aurora at Cayuga Park, including wood framing, finish carpentry, and paver and sun shade installation.

The coordination of both the field team and the internal office allowed for this project to be completed ahead of schedule.

There were 2 buildings on site, totalling over 132,000 square feet of framing. Led by Jeremy Spicer, the framing teams of around 15 crew members per building worked 12-hour days to see the project to an efficient completion. As the materials for framing and pavers ran low, seamless coordination with TenM's internal operations staff ensured timely deliveries, eliminating potential delays and keeping the project on schedule.

“Communication is everything from our office down to our field team, especially when handling multi-trade scopes,” states Zach Schiffer.

The rough carpentry phase transitioned smoothly into finish carpentry, keeping the project moving without interruption. Our framing crews established the structural envelope before handing off to skilled finish carpenters, who installed sliding closet and entry doors, base trim, and hardware throughout the interior. The project concluded with paver installation and exterior sunshade installation, delivering a polished finish inside and out.
